Taloja is a census town in the Raigad district of Navi Mumbai city, in the Indian state of Maharashtra. It is an extension of the Kharghar node and governed by the Panvel Municipal Corporation. The Navi Mumbai Metro Phase I originates from the Pendhar station in Taloja. CIDCO has divided Taloja into Phase I and Phase II. It has developed a mass housing project in Phase II, and development work is currently in progress. The town is connected to parts of Navi Mumbai through Indian Railways, Navi Mumbai Metro, and NMMT buses and will eventually be served by the Navi Mumbai International Airport.

Demographics

As of 2001 India census, Taloje Panchnand had a population of 10,858. Males constitute 54% of the population and females 46%. Taloje Panchnand has an average literacy rate of 68%, higher than the national average of 59.5%: male literacy is 73%, and female literacy is 61%. In Taloje Panchnand, 18% of the population is under 6 years of age.[1]
